| Ironworkers 22 Training and safety are top priorities for the Ironworkers, who climb rigging, build bridges, work with structural iron and rebar, and move heavy machinery. In their four-year program, apprentices spend 400 hours in the classroom and 1,000 hours in closely supervised on-the-job training each year. Mastery of their trade includes studies in blueprint reading, structural steel properties and handling, power rigging, rebar work, chain link fencing, welding, ornamental and sheeting work, and pre-cast concrete and post tensioning. They also focus on safety precautions and protection for others, so vital in their work. Applications are accepted year round, and about 20 apprentices are chosen each year. Journeymen also continue education throughout their career, with upgrade classes in hazardous material handling, confined space training, OSHA safety procedures, advanced welding, and CPR. Recent and current projects include many at Purdue University: Mechanical Engineering, Mackey Arena, Meadow Lake Wind Farm, Fowler Ridge Wind Farm and Hoosier Wind Farm. Industrial work includes Caterpillar, Ice Cream Specialties, Lilly Tippecanoe Labs and Subaru of America Automotive Inc. They’ve also worked on the Clarian Arnett and St. Elizabeth hospitals, the Pearl River Lift Station and the West Lafayette Wastewater Treatment Plan, among other projects. In community service, the Ironworkers furnish the building and utilities for the Union Food Pantry. They also volunteered time at Triangle Park and set the globe fountain at the Columbian Park Zoo.
